“You Don’t See In Me What I See In You” by Luke Porter: demonstrating the strength and diversity of music being produced in the North East of England. Hailing from Newcastle upon Tyne, this gem of a song is a modern blues-influenced song that could fool someone into thinking they’re listening to an artists from the US. A wonderful song filled with authenticity.

“Roadside” by 100 Fables: a bittersweet Alternative-Pop that demonstrates a vast amount of creativity and a flair for lyrics. Impressive vocals work with smooth production creating a superb song with polished finesse.

“Bother You” by Amy Lou: a song that exudes personality and character. Full of emotion and delivered with passion, the lyrics demonstrate a level of sincerity that grabs the listeners attention right from the start.
